ERP数据库的搭建与核心字段设计,是电商企业实现高效、智能管理的关键基础。
- 合理的数据库架构决定了ERP系统的稳定性、可扩展性和数据处理效率。
- 核心字段的选取,直接影响数据流转的准确性和管理流程的自动化水平。
- ERP数据库搭建不仅要聚焦业务支撑,还要为数据分析和决策提供全面的数据底层保障。
- 科学的运行基础设计,能够帮助企业降低运维成本,提升响应速度,适应电商行业的变化与挑战。
本文将带你系统了解ERP数据库整体搭建框架、核心字段设置的行业最佳实践,以及如何为企业的业务运营和数据驱动决策打下坚实基础。无论你是电商运营负责人、IT技术负责人,还是ERP项目实施顾问,都能从中获得超越基础认知的实用洞见。
一、ERP数据库搭建框架:稳如磐石的系统根基
1. 逻辑架构:分层设计,保障灵活与性能
一个高效的ERP数据库架构,首要体现为清晰的分层设计。 电商企业的业务复杂多变,数据量增长迅猛,数据库架构必须既能适应当前业务,又具备应对未来扩展的灵活性。分层设计是主流做法,具体包括:
- 数据采集层:负责从订单系统、库存系统、第三方平台等多源采集原始数据,确保数据全面且实时。
- 数据存储层:将采集到的数据存入结构化数据库,如MySQL、PostgreSQL或Oracle,部分场景也用NoSQL(如MongoDB)存储半结构化数据。
- 业务处理层:通过存储过程、触发器、业务逻辑代码处理业务流转,实现订单、采购、库存、财务等业务数据的自动化流转。
- 分析展现层:为BI工具、报表系统等提供标准化数据接口,支持大屏展示和多维分析,驱动智能决策。
层次分明的架构不仅优化了数据库性能,还便于业务扩展与模块解耦。 随着业务发展,电商企业可根据实际需求灵活拓展分析层模块,融入大数据、AI等新技术,做到“旧有业务不受冲击,新业务快速上线”。
2. 数据规范与标准化:数据质量的生命线
标准化是ERP数据库架构的灵魂。 数据标准化不仅仅是字段命名统一,更涵盖数据类型、编码规则、主外键约束、数据冗余控制等核心原则。典型电商ERP项目的数据库标准实践包括:
- 字段命名统一:采用全局唯一、语义明确的字段命名规范(如order_id、sku_code、amount等)。
- 数据类型规范:根据业务需求精细区分整型、浮点型、字符串、日期类型,避免溢出和精度丢失问题。
- 主外键约束:关键业务表间建立主外键关系,保证数据一致性与完整性。
- 冗余字段控制:在性能允许的前提下,适度冗余关键字段,提升查询效率,减少复杂Join操作。
数据标准化为后续的数据分析、异构系统集成和业务流程再造提供坚实保障。 特别是电商平台多业务、多渠道场景下,统一的数据规范有助于避免“信息孤岛”,实现数据的高效流转和价值最大化。
3. 高可用性与扩展性:应对电商业务高并发与弹性增长
ERP数据库架构必须具备高可用性与横向扩展能力。 电商企业在大促、秒杀等场景下,业务流量激增,数据库的稳定运行直接关乎整体业务成败。主流实现手段包括:
- 主从复制与分布式架构:通过读写分离、分库分表,提升系统负载能力和容灾水平。
- 备份与热备机制:定期全量备份+增量备份,结合热备方案,确保数据安全,快速恢复。
- 性能优化策略:索引优化、SQL调优、缓存机制(如Redis)、分片机制等,降低数据库延迟。
- 云原生与容器化部署:利用云数据库和Kubernetes等技术,弹性扩容、降本增效。
具备高可用与易扩展能力的ERP数据库,是电商企业应对市场变化、保障业务连续性的关键底层支撑。
二、核心字段设计:数据流转的精准脉络
1. 订单管理核心字段:全链路可追溯
订单表是电商ERP系统的核心,字段设计需兼顾业务复杂性与后续分析需求。 一个标准的订单表核心字段包括:
- 订单ID(order_id):全局唯一,便于数据追踪。
- 用户ID(user_id):支撑会员分析、用户画像。
- SKU编码(sku_code):关联商品、库存等模块。
- 订单状态(order_status):如待付款、已发货、已完成、已关闭,支持业务流转自动化。
- 下单时间、支付时间、发货时间、完成时间:多时间戳字段,满足流程分析和履约监控。
- 应付金额、实付金额、优惠金额、运费:细分财务字段,便于毛利、成本、优惠核算。
- 收货地址、联系方式:支撑物流管理与风险控制。
科学的订单表字段设计,既便于业务流程自动化,也为后续的数据分析与BI场景打下坚实基础。 例如,九数云BI可直接基于标准订单表结构,实现订单转化漏斗、支付转化率、订单生命周期等多维分析,帮助卖家实时洞察业务瓶颈与增长机会。
2. 商品与库存管理字段:精准管控、动态更新
商品表与库存表的数据设计,直接影响ERP系统对商品生命周期与库存流转的精细管控能力。 商品表需包含:
- 商品ID(product_id)、SKU编码(sku_code):唯一识别商品,支持多规格、多渠道管理。
- 商品名称、类目ID、品牌ID:支撑商品分组与品牌分析。
- 上下架状态、创建/更新时间:追踪商品生命周期。
- 商品成本价、建议售价、当前售价:为毛利率、促销分析提供数据基础。
库存表则需紧密关联商品表,核心字段设计包括:
- 仓库ID(warehouse_id):多仓储并行管理。
- 库存数量、在途库存、锁定库存、可用库存:多维库存状态,支撑自动补货与风险预警。
- 库存变动类型(如采购入库、销售出库、盘点调整等):便于库存流转追溯与异常报警。
精准的商品与库存字段设计,实现了自动化库存预警、动态分仓管理和库存周转分析,减少缺货与库存积压风险。
3. 财务与对账字段:智能化合规管控
财务数据的底层字段,是ERP数据库最需谨慎设计的部分,直接影响企业合规和利润核算。 典型的财务表涉及:
- 财务单据ID(finance_id):唯一标识每一笔财务动作。
- 订单ID、用户ID、商家ID:实现跨模块对账。
- 收入/支出类型(如销售收入、退款支出、佣金、运费等):细分类目,便于精细化管控。
- 金额字段(应收、实收、应付、实付、税费等):多角度支持利润、成本、现金流分析。
- 对账状态、对账时间:自动对账、异常预警的基础。
合规且精细的财务字段设计,使ERP系统能够自动生成利润表、现金流量表、应收应付明细等关键报表。 对于高成长型电商企业,自动化财务对账与审计能力尤为重要,既节省人力,又提升数据准确率和决策效率。
4. 用户与权限字段:支撑多角色协同与数据安全
用户表与权限表的字段设计,关乎ERP系统的数据安全和多角色协同能力。 用户表需包含:
- 用户ID、用户名、手机号/邮箱:支持多渠道登录与身份唯一性。
- 用户类型(如管理员、采购员、仓库员、财务等):便于权限分配和操作记录。
- 账户状态、创建/更新时间、最近登录时间:追踪用户生命周期和安全监控。
权限表(role/permission)则需具备:
- 角色ID、角色名称:支撑岗位分工。
- 权限码、权限说明:细致到功能按钮级别,确保数据安全最小授权原则。
- 角色-用户关联表,灵活分配用户权限。
精细化的用户与权限字段设计,既满足内部协同,又可对接第三方平台,实现单点登录(SSO)、多渠道数据安全管控。
三、ERP数据库的运行基础:高效支撑电商业务全流程
1. 数据一致性与事务管理:保障流程严密无误
数据一致性,是ERP数据库运行的生命线。 电商ERP涉及订单、库存、财务等多表强关联业务,任何环节数据异常都可能引发连锁反应,带来客户投诉、财务损失甚至合规风险。主流一致性实现方式包括:
- ACID事务保障:采用关系型数据库的原子性、一致性、隔离性、持久性机制,确保订单-库存-财务多表操作“要么全成、要么全不成”。
- 分布式事务协调:对于分库分表、微服务架构,采用两阶段提交、消息队列补偿等方式,保障跨系统一致性。
- 乐观锁/悲观锁机制:解决高并发下的库存超卖、数据脏读等问题。
高一致性的事务管理,让ERP数据库成为电商企业业务流程自动化、智能化的坚实后盾。
2. 数据安全与权限防护:底层安全不容忽视
ERP数据库的安全防护,直接关联企业核心资产的安全与合规。 电商行业数据资产价值巨大,数据库安全设计需覆盖:
- 数据加密存储:对用户隐私、交易数据、财务数据采用加密技术,防止数据泄露。
- 细粒度权限控制:通过权限表实现最小授权,防止越权操作。
- 数据访问审计:全程记录关键操作日志,支持溯源和合规审计。
- 防SQL注入与越权访问:采用参数化查询、白名单机制,提升数据库抗攻击能力。
健全的安全体系,让ERP数据库能承受外部攻击和内部违规操作双重考验,保障数据不丢不乱。
3. 高性能运维与监控:保障业务7*24无间断
电商业务无时无刻不在运行,ERP数据库必须具备高性能和智能运维能力。 主流实践包括:
- 自动化监控与报警:实时采集数据库运行指标(CPU、IO、慢查询、连接数等),异常自动报警。
- 自动扩容与负载均衡:根据业务流量动态扩缩数据库资源,防止性能瓶颈。
- 定期巡检与健康报告:自动生成数据库健康报告,提前识别潜在风险。
- 可视化运维大屏:运维工程师可通过大屏实时掌控数据库运行状态,快速定位故障。
高效的运维体系,确保ERP数据库为电商业务提供7*24小时的稳定支撑。 对于需要大屏报表、电商数据分析的场景,推荐九数云BI免费在线试用,作为高成长型企业首选SAAS BI品牌,提供从淘宝、天猫、京东、拼多多到ERP、直播、会员、财务、库存等全渠道数据分析和大屏制作解决方案,自动化计算销售、财务、绩效、库存数据,帮助卖家全局洞察业务,提升决策效率。
四、总结与推荐:让ERP数据库赋能电商智慧管理
ERP数据库的科学搭建,是电商企业实现高效、智能管理的根本保障。 合理的分层架构设计、核心字段的精细打磨、高可用与安全运维体系,共同支撑起订单、商品、库存、财务、用户等全流程管理需求。对于追求精细化运营与智能决策的电商企业,ERP数据库不仅是业务“账本”,更是数据驱动增长的“引擎”。如果你希望在电商数据分析、报表、大屏制作等方面进一步提升效率和洞察力,务必试试九数云BI免费在线试用,让数据成为你决胜市场的最强武器。
## 本文相关FAQs
本文相关FAQs
电商ERP数据库的搭建框架应该如何规划?
ERP数据库的框架设计,是电商企业数字化管理的根本。一个科学合理的数据库架构,不仅能高效承载订单、商品、会员等核心业务数据,还能为后续的业务扩展和数据分析提供坚实基础。通常,电商ERP数据库的搭建会围绕以下几个方面进行:
- 模块化设计:将订单、商品、库存、会员、财务等核心业务板块拆分为独立的子系统,每个模块有自己的数据表和接口,方便日后维护和扩展。
- 高内聚、低耦合:通过数据表的主外键关联,既保证了数据完整性,又使得模块之间解耦,减少系统间的相互依赖。
- 冗余与性能平衡:部分关键字段(如商品名称、订单状态)可以适度冗余在多张表内,提升查询效率,但需注意数据同步和一致性。
- 索引与分库分表:为高频查询的字段建立索引,大型电商应考虑水平分库分表,缓解单库压力,提升并发处理能力。
- 日志和历史表:为保证数据安全和可追溯性,核心业务(如订单、库存)需要设计日志表或历史表,记录每次变更。
合理的数据库框架不仅让数据流转更顺畅,还为后续的BI报表、数据分析、AI智能决策等高级功能打下基础。框架设计时建议充分考虑业务发展未来三到五年的扩展需求,预留接口和冗余空间,避免后期大规模重构带来的高昂成本。
电商ERP数据库的核心字段有哪些?为什么这些字段特别重要?
电商ERP数据库的核心字段,决定了系统对业务数据的描述能力和处理深度。一般而言,以下这些字段是每个电商ERP数据库必不可少的:
- 订单相关:订单号(唯一标识)、用户ID、商品ID、订单状态、下单时间、支付方式、支付状态、配送方式、物流单号、收货地址、订单金额、优惠信息等。
- 商品相关:商品ID、SKU编码、商品名称、品类、品牌、成本价、售价、库存数量、上下架状态、图片URL、属性参数等。
- 会员相关:会员ID、手机号、注册时间、会员等级、积分、消费累计、最近活跃时间、收货地址、偏好标签等。
- 库存相关:仓库ID、商品ID、库存现有量、预占库存、可用库存、库存变动记录。
- 财务相关:账单ID、关联订单号、收支类型、金额、账户、支付时间、对账状态。
这些字段之所以重要,是因为它们直接反映了电商业务的核心流程,支撑着订单履约、商品管理、用户运营和财务核算等关键环节。字段设计要兼顾数据的唯一性、完整性和可追溯性。比如订单号、商品ID、会员ID等都应全局唯一,避免数据混乱;而订单状态、支付状态等则要预留足够的状态值,适应不同业务场景的扩展。
一个健全的核心字段体系,是ERP系统稳定运行和后续智能化分析的坚实基础。
ERP数据库设计时,如何兼顾性能与灵活性?
ERP数据库在设计时,既要保障高并发处理能力,又要支持业务灵活变化。这其实是一个平衡艺术。主要有以下几种常用做法:
- 预留扩展字段:为商品、订单等表设计扩展字段(如JSON类型的属性字段),方便后续新增自定义信息,而不必频繁改表结构。
- 冷热数据分离:将历史订单、过期活动等“冷数据”迁移到专门的归档表或数据仓库,主库只保留活跃数据,提升查询速度。
- 分库分表策略:当单表数据量巨大时,按照时间、用户、订单号等维度水平分表,或者将读写压力拆分到不同数据库服务器。
- 合理建立索引:针对高频查询的字段(如订单号、SKU、用户ID)建立合适的索引,加快检索速度,同时避免过多索引导致写入性能下降。
- 业务无关表外置:如日志、操作记录等不影响主业务的表,可以单独拉出,减少对核心业务表的压力。
值得注意的是,业务灵活性经常意味着字段和表结构会发生变动。数据库设计时建议采用“宽表+扩展表”混合模式:宽表承载高频、刚需字段,扩展表存储灵活变化的业务字段,两者通过主键关联,既保证了稳定性,又能适应多变业务需求。
随着业务数据量和复杂度的上升,推荐使用专业的数据分析工具,比如九数云BI,它支持多源数据对接和复杂数据建模,帮电商企业快速洞察各环节数据,优化决策链路。是高成长型电商企业的数据分析首选BI工具。九数云BI免费在线试用
ERP数据库如何保障数据安全与合规性?
对于电商企业而言,ERP数据库常常包含订单、支付、用户等敏感信息,数据安全和合规性不容忽视。数据库的安全保障要做到“事前预防、事中监控、事后追溯”,主要可以从以下几个方向着手:
- 权限分级管理:为不同岗位的员工分配不同的数据访问权限,防止数据泄露和误操作。比如客服只能读订单数据,财务可查账单,但不能改订单。
- 数据加密存储:对手机号、身份证号、支付账号等敏感字段进行加密处理,防止数据库被窃取后数据外泄。
- 数据备份与灾备:定期全量与增量备份,保证系统出现故障时能快速恢复;同时设置异地灾备,防止单点故障导致数据不可用。
- 操作日志审计:所有增删改操作都记录详细日志,便于后续追溯和责任划分。
- 合规要求:遵循《网络安全法》、《个人信息保护法》等国家法规,确保数据存储、传输、处理全流程满足合规要求。
数据安全是一项长期且持续的工程,企业要结合自身规模和业务特点,定期评估和优化安全策略,做到防患于未然。
电商ERP数据库如何为数据分析和智能运营提供支撑?
ERP数据库的价值不仅体现在支撑日常业务,更在于为企业数据分析和智能运营奠定基础。一个结构清晰、数据完整的ERP数据库,可以让企业实现:
- 多维度数据分析:销售、库存、营销、客户等多板块数据打通,支持订单分析、用户画像、商品热度排行等多维分析需求。
- 实时数据监控:通过数据同步和ETL,业务数据可以被实时抽取到BI平台,管理层随时掌控业务动态,及时决策。
- 高效数据建模:数据结构标准化,便于数据仓库、数据湖等中台化建设,为后续AI建模和智能推荐打基础。
- 自动化运营:基于数据分析结果,ERP可自动触发补货、预警、营销等智能运营动作,减少人工干预。
电商企业若想真正发挥数据价值,建议从源头做好数据库设计,同时接入专业BI工具,实现数据可视化和智能运营闭环。这样不仅能提升运营效率,还能增强企业的核心竞争力。
